Nicole Scherzinger has supposedly quit X Factor UK.

The 35-year-old former Pussycat Doll served as judge on the programme from 2006 to 2013.

And according to sources, she recently decided to leave the TV talent competition.

“It breaks her heart, but Nicole is sad not to be able to go back to the show this year,” a source told British newspaper The Sun.

Nicole was a panellist on seasons five, seven, nine and ten of the show, and it is claimed she was distraught over having to say goodbye.

But the songstress recently signed a record deal with Sony, and she reportedly wants to get her solo career on the move again.

“She has agonised over this decision for months,” the insider noted.

“She put her music career on hold last year but now she has to focus on her music.”

Apparently Nicole’s decision hasn’t generated any animosity from her X Factor colleagues.

The cast and crew supposedly wish her well.

“She will always be part of the X Factor family,” the source said.

The show’s creator, music mogul Simon Cowell, announced last Friday the X Factor USA is cancelled and he will be returning to the X Factor UK as a judge.

Both the British and American version of the shows have been suffering low ratings for quite some time.

It is thought Cheryl Cole will replace Nicole on the panel, but rumours are circulating Rita Ora is also a top choice for the job.
